Booking/cancellation policies

Our booking policies for the Resurrection Bay half day tour is a minimum of 2 passengers or 2 seats booked on the same tour. if there is only one seat purchased you may purchase the other seat and have an exclusive tour to yourself.

For our Full Day tour is a minimum of 2 passengers or 2 seats booked on the same tour. if there is only one seat purchased you may purchase the other seats and have an exclusive tour to yourself.

Our cancelation policies are that for a full 100% refund you need to cancel 14 days before your tour, anything under 14 days may receive up to 50% refund. if you cancel within 24 hours or no show to your tour you will not be receiving a refund. make sure to give yourself time to get to the boat and be 15 to 5 minutes early to avoid this.

We will try our hardest to not have to cancel your tour or have anything go wrong but sometimes mother nature has different planes. if the event comes around where weather or mechanical issues happen, we can give out full refunds if we can't leave the harbor, possibly be able to reschedule your tour for a later date or if the tour gets cut short for any reason, we can give out a partial refund for the remainder of time.

Can we guarantee whales?

While we will always try our best to be able to see everything, especially whales, there are no guarantees that they will always be there and hope everyone can understand that.

Will there be glaciers?

On our shorter 3.5-hour tour there will not be much for glaciers. On the 7-hour tour there will be much more for glaciers because of how much more we can explore.

Is there a bathroom on board the boat?

 

Yes! we have a bathroom on board.

What should you wear on the tour?

Hopefully the weather will be nice and warm but that's not always the case, so we do recommend you bring warm clothes like a coat, pants, and no open toe shoes.

Will there be snacks or food on the tour?

We will have small snacks on board like trail mix and snack bars and also coffee but if you want to bring some with you feel free. We will have bottled water available also.

Is it customary to tip after your tour?

Always welcomed if you feel like we did a great job and had a good time, but it is not required.
